Door contractors deal with a range of door types, each serving different functions and styles. Below are some common Advanced Door Installers types contractors usually manage:
Type of DoorDescriptionInterior DoorsDoors within the home, usually made from wood, hollow-core, or fiberglass. Used for spaces like bedrooms, restrooms, and workplaces.Exterior DoorsFront, back, and side doors that offer entry into the home. Often made from wood, steel, or fiberglass, and created for security and insulation.Patio DoorsSliding or French doors that offer access to outside areas. Usually made from glass and framed in aluminum or wood.Garage DoorsLarge doors that provide access to a garage, usually automated and can be built from metal, wood, or composite products.Storm DoorsExtra doors set up in front of exterior doors for included security against weather condition elements and improved energy efficiency.Bi-Fold DoorsDoors that fold to provide large access points, frequently used in closets, laundry rooms, and as outdoor patio doors.How to Find Reliable Door Contractors
Finding a dependable door professional needs cautious research and factor to consider. Here are some actions to assist in discovering the ideal specialist for your project:

Ask for Recommendations: Begin your search by asking good friends, household, or next-door neighbors for referrals. Individual experiences can provide valuable insights.

Online Research: Utilize sites like Yelp, Angie's List, or Google Reviews to check out evaluations and testimonials from previous consumers.

Check Credentials: Ensure the Professional Door Installers holds the required licenses and insurance. This safeguards you in case of accidents or damages during the project.

Interview Contractors: Speak with numerous contractors to assess their experience, proficiency, and interaction style. Inquire about their method to the particular work you require done.

Demand Estimates: Obtain comprehensive composed estimates from a few contractors to compare pricing and scope of work. Guarantee these estimates break down the costs of materials and labor.

Evaluation Contracts: Carefully gone through all contracts before finalizing. Look for clarity on timelines, payment schedules, warranties, and contingencies.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)What should I think about when selecting door materials?
Picking door materials involves considering aspects such as security, resilience, insulation residential or commercial properties, and visual appeals. Common products include wood, fiberglass, metal, and composite, each with pros and cons.
For how long does door installation usually take?
The duration of door installation varies based on aspects like the type of door and any extra work required (e.g., customizing the frame). Typically, a standard door installation can draw from a few hours to a full day.
Is it worth hiring a door contractor for small repair work?
Yes, even minor repairs can gain from a contractor's expertise. Trying DIY repair work might lead to additional issues if not done properly, while a professional will ensure a correct and long lasting repair.
Do door contractors provide warranties on their work?
Lots of reputable contractors offer guarantees on their setups. This assurance can vary from a few months to a number of years, depending upon the contractor and kind of work carried out.
How can I ensure my job remains within spending plan?
To manage your budget, ensure clear interaction with your professional concerning expenses. Ask for a detailed breakdown of approximated costs and maintain a contingency fund for unforeseen concerns.
